Show Notes
- Why do we need to recalibrate our hearts? A review.
- When we pray scripture, are we mindful of what we're actually praying for? Do we know how to see specific answers?
- God isn't interested in punishing us for our mistakes; He is interested in drawing us back to Him.
- Only God can recalibrate our hearts. Our part is to embrace what He is doing in our lives (Rom. 12:1, The Message)
- The first question God asked humans was, "where are you?" (Gen. 3:9)
- In order to experience our best life with God we need to get our physical, mental, and spiritual lives in sync with God's Spirit in us.
- How to use the Recalibration Checklist.
- You're not looking for solutions in the first step of the process. You're just truthfully answering the questions to find out where you are.
- We start the process of recalibrating with small incremental steps, not large, unattainable goals.
- Prayer is a necessity all throughout the process. Prayers before you start (personalize them): Psalm 46:10, James 1:5 (the promise of wisdom), Philippians 4:6.
Scriptures used in this episode:
- Eph. 3:17, Psalm 139:23-24, Psalm 51:10, Romans 12:1, Gen. 3:9, 1 Peter 3:11, Luke 11:24-26, James 1:3-4
